Types of Senior Discounts
Senior discounts can be broadly categorized into several types, each offering unique benefits and savings opportunities. Understanding these categories can help seniors identify which discounts are most relevant to their needs and how to access them effectively.
Retail Discounts
Many retailers offer discounts to seniors, allowing them to save on everyday purchases. These discounts can range from a percentage off the total purchase to special pricing on select items. Retailers such as Kohl's, Walgreens, and Ross Stores are known for offering senior discounts, often on specific days of the week.
Dining Discounts
Restaurants and cafes frequently offer discounts to senior patrons, making dining out more affordable. Chains like Denny's, IHOP, and Applebee's provide special menus or discounts for seniors, often resulting in significant savings on meals.
Travel Discounts
Travel discounts are particularly popular among seniors, offering reduced rates on transportation, accommodations, and attractions. Airlines, hotels, and car rental companies often provide special rates for seniors, while organizations like AARP offer additional travel-related benefits.
Entertainment Discounts
Seniors can also enjoy discounts on entertainment options such as movie tickets, museum admissions, and theater performances. Venues like AMC Theatres and various local museums offer reduced pricing for seniors, making cultural and recreational activities more accessible.

Comparison of Senior Discounts
| Category | Example | Discount Details |
|---|---|---|
| Retail | Kohl's | 15% off on Wednesdays for 60+ |
| Dining | Denny's | Special senior menu with discounted pricing |
| Travel | Amtrak | 10% off for seniors 65+ |
| Entertainment | AMC Theatres | Discounted movie tickets for seniors |
| Healthcare | Walgreens | Discounts on select wellness products |
How to Access Senior Discounts
Accessing senior discounts is often straightforward, but it requires awareness and sometimes a little initiative. Here are some tips to help seniors take full advantage of available discounts:
- Ask for Discounts: Always inquire about senior discounts when making a purchase or booking a service. Many businesses offer discounts that are not advertised.
- Join Senior Organizations: Memberships with organizations like AARP can provide access to a wide range of discounts and benefits.
- Check Online: Many companies list their senior discounts on their websites, making it easy to find deals and promotions.
- Use Identification: Be prepared to show proof of age, such as a driver's license, to qualify for discounts.
